Default Re: How Are These Heads ???

Just be careful: The same store pushes Pro Comp Roller Rockers, Pro Comp Distributors, and Pro Comp SBC heads. Take a look at there E-Bay store.

Just the name Pro Comp is misleading - don't you see any similarities ? Pro (to look like Pro Action) and Comp (to look like Comp Cams whou bought Pro Action) and etc,etc,etc.

Then they tie in the whole mess by lying aabout made in Australia (Pro Action is from Australia) to try to seal the deal.

Yes, there stuff is ****, but even if it was top rate I would still be adamant about not buying it. Lies are lies, money going out of country, and they have no R&D department. All they do is copy, give it to Mr China Man to make, and sell to the unknowing.

People get blind when they see a killer bargain. Reason why so many companies and indivduals selling crap on E-Bay. When I say crap, I mean crap. Some others do sell regular stuff.

Default Re: How Are These Heads ???

Originally Posted by the duke
There wording is VERY well done. They say
"As with the existing Pro Top Line range, accuracy and detail are at there highest" They NEVER say that they are pro topline, but it reads that way when you read the whole thing through quickly

Now, how did they get 100% feedback? Ebay gets worse every day!
1) People looking to put together a high quality HP motor do not go to E-Bay to buy new 'unknown,unmarked' heads that are $800 to $1000+ cheaper than known high quality heads.

2) E-bay places that have great feedback does not mean they don't have a lot of problems. Many sellers will force customers to provide 'good feedback' like:
"We will not perform a credit without good feedback"
"We will replace them if you give us good feedback"
"We will attempt to repair if you give us good feedback"
etc,etc,etc.

Also, do you really think people that buy these types of things ie:meaning they don't know what they are buying - really know if these caused problems or not ? Or if they really aren't who the purchaser thinks thery are ? Or if the performance isn't as great as it should ? Or the valvetrain pieces are cheap **** ? Or...............

Anyway - $$$$ blinds people. Proof in point.
